Honduras is a member country to the Central American Border Control Agreement (CA-4), along with: El Salvador; Guatemala; Nicaragua; With a CA-4 tourist visa, you can travel freely by land between member countries within the 90-day period. Certain items will help keep you safe during your trip to Honduras, such as a secure, slash proof, lockable backpack and a money belt that you can wear underneath your clothes. Today ( 2019 ), the murder rate of San Pedro Sula in Honduras is 51.2 for every 100,000 people per year. According to the National Violence Observatory (NVO), the murder rates have been slowly but consistently going down from 86.5 per 100,000 people in 2011 to 59.0 per 100,000 people in 2016.
